服务器一般是什么代码的

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器一般是通过编写后端代码来实现的。

    后端开发可以使用多种编程语言来编写服务器代码,常见的包括但不限于以下几种:

    1. Java:Java是一种广泛应用于服务器端开发的编程语言,它具有跨平台特性以及强大的生态系统支持,如Java Servlet、JavaServer Pages (JSP),以及各种开源框架如Spring、Hibernate等。

    2. Python:Python是一种简单、易用且高效的编程语言,它在服务器端开发领域也有很大的应用。Python的Web开发框架Flask和Django非常受开发者欢迎,并且有许多其他的库和框架可供选择。

    3. Ruby:Ruby是一种简洁灵活的动态编程语言,它的Web开发框架Ruby on Rails(简称Rails)被广泛应用于快速开发高效的Web应用程序。

    4. PHP:PHP是一种特别用于Web开发的编程语言,它的语法易于学习和使用。PHP的流行框架如Laravel和Symfony提供了丰富的功能和工具,使开发者能够更快速地构建高质量的Web应用。

    5. Node.js:Node.js是建立在Chrome V8 JavaScript引擎之上的JavaScript运行时环境,它让JavaScript可以用于服务器端开发。Node.js配合Express.js等框架,可以构建高性能的网络应用。

    除了以上列举的语言外,还有C#、Go、Perl等等,都可以用来编写服务器代码,具体选择哪种语言取决于项目需求、开发团队的技术背景以及性能和扩展性要求等因素。

    综上所述,服务器一般可以使用多种编程语言来编写后端代码,开发人员可以根据具体需求和技术优势选择适合的语言。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器可以运行多种类型的代码来提供服务。以下是一些常见的服务器代码类型:

    1. HTML/CSS:服务器可以使用HTML和CSS代码来生成和呈现网页。这种类型的服务器代码通常用于静态网页,它们会在浏览器发出请求时将预先生成的HTML和CSS文件发送给客户端。

    2. JavaScript:服务器可以使用JavaScript代码来响应客户端的请求,并生成和返回动态内容。例如,服务器可以使用Node.js等JavaScript运行时来处理来自客户端的请求,执行各种操作,并返回生成的网页或数据。

    3. PHP:服务器可以使用PHP(超文本预处理器)代码来生成和处理网页。PHP是一种非常流行的服务器端脚本语言,它可以与HTML代码混合使用,使服务器能够动态地生成网页内容。PHP代码可以在服务器上解释和执行,并在生成响应时将结果发送给客户端。

    4. Ruby:服务器可以使用Ruby代码来处理客户端请求和生成响应。Ruby是一种灵活的面向对象编程语言,可以用于开发Web应用程序。Ruby on Rails是一种流行的服务器端框架,它使用Ruby编写,并提供了许多构建Web应用程序所需的功能。

    5. Python:服务器可以使用Python代码来处理客户端请求,并生成响应。Python是一种高级编程语言,具有简单易学的语法,广泛用于Web开发。Django是一种使用Python编写的流行的服务器端框架,它提供了许多方便的功能来开发Web应用程序。

    需要注意的是,服务器可以运行其他编程语言的代码,这只是一些常见的选项。最终选择服务器代码的类型取决于应用程序的需求、开发团队的技能和偏好等因素。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器通常使用一种编程语言编写,可以是任何一种编程语言,如Java、Python、C++等。代码的选择通常取决于服务器的需求和开发团队的技术背景。

    以下是常用的服务器编程语言及其特点:

    1. Java:Java是一种跨平台的编程语言,非常适合构建大型服务器应用程序。Java具有丰富的库和框架,可以用于开发高性能、可扩展的服务器。常用的Java服务器框架有Spring Boot、JavaEE等。

    2. Python:Python是一种简单易学且功能强大的编程语言,适合快速开发和原型验证。Python的服务器编程常用于Web开发,常用的服务器框架有Django、Flask等。

    3. C++:C++是一种高效的系统级编程语言,适合开发高性能的服务器应用。C++的服务器编程通常用于构建底层服务和网络通信,常用的服务器框架有Boost.Asio等。

    4. Node.js:Node.js是一个基于Chrome V8引擎的JavaScript运行时环境,用于构建高性能的服务器端应用。Node.js具有事件驱动、非阻塞IO等特点,适合处理大量并发请求。常用的Node.js服务器框架有Express、Koa等。

    根据服务器的需求,可以选择合适的编程语言和相应的框架进行开发。开发人员可以根据自身的技术背景和项目要求选择合适的编程语言和框架来构建服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部